Jordan Fabrics is a team of 15 people, including Matt, Donna, and their son James Jordan. We film, edit, cut, and sew everything you see right here in our Oregon workshop. Matt spends most of the day making very unique hand cut quilting kits, If you love sewing and quilting, but don't love the cutting, our fully pre-cut quilt and table runner kits are made for you! We don't actually use table runners and placemats in our house. However, I've been studying these tutorials with interest because I have started making baby quilts for Project Linus UK and almost *any* of these patterns could easily be turned into a baby quilt. This set of placemats, for instance, could be done quite easily perhaps with some narrow sashing in between or just pushed together as one quilt top. The flip method is nice and easy to use with baby quilts, as I don't use any binding on mine, just a quilt top with either some batting and a soft flannel backing or with a fleece backing and no batting. Also, I only want minimal stitch in the ditch quilting, so this method works really well for that. Thanks for all the helpful tutorials on these items!
